The 1st MALAYSIA ART EDUCATION SEMINAR

The Malaysian Junior Art Education Association (MJAEA), a non-government organization, cordially invites you to participate in The 1st MALAYSIA ART EDUCATION SEMINAR

Date: 21st & 22nd November 2013
Venue: Menara PGRM, Cheras, Kuala Lumpur.


 Seminar Aims:
• to stimulate dialogue and exchange between theory, research and practice in art education
• to enhance the role of art education in promotion of creativity in art, social responsibility, social cohesion, cultural diversity and intercultural dialogue.

Seminar Theme:
Three key themes which are highlighted in the Seminar presentations are:
DIVERSITY, INCLUSION and QUALITY.
Diversity includes awareness, knowledge and communication of cultural practices to celebrate heritage, identities, and values through art and learning;
Inclusion indicates expanding horizons in the arts to promote dynamic integration with socially, culturally, and globally embedded perspectives.
Quality relates to Balancing cognitive development and emotional process through creative teaching and active learning.
